This Day in Diocesan History for February 1

1929

The Polish parish of Our Lady of Perpetual Help, Natrona Heights established

 
 
1935

St. Augustine High School, Lawrenceville receives state accreditation

 
 
1941

Regina Coeli Parish, North Side begins renovations to the recently purchased Tenth United Presbyterian Church.  The building would later be dedicated as the mission church of Mary Immaculate

 
 
1961

The first St. Henry School, Arlington Heights closed

 
 
1967

The Family Life Center opened in Oakland to offer educational and medical consultation on family life problems
